GASTAT’s President holds bilateral meetings with international statistical leaders during Saudi Statistics Forum

29-04-2025

                                    
GASTAT’s President, Dr. Fahad Aldossari, held a series of bilateral meetings with several heads and directors of international organizations and statistical centers during the Saudi Statistics Forum. The forum was hosted in Riyadh from April 27-28, 2025.
These meetings involved discussions on areas of bilateral cooperation, exploring opportunities for integration and the exchange of expertise in developing statistical work, and examining ways to expand partnerships with leading statistical entities at both regional and international levels. The aim was to enhance data quality and contribute to the development of statistical products and indicators that support decision-making.
The meetings included discussions with: Dr. Johannes Jutting, Executive Head of PARIS21; Dr. Ola Awad, President of PCBS; Dr. Steve Macfeely, OECD Chief Statistician; Professor Xuming He, President of ISI; Mr. Mohamed Bin Ahmed Al Obaidly, Director-General of the National Statistics Center of Qatar; Intisar Abdullah Al Wahaibi, Director General of the GCC Statistical Centre;   Dr. Diaa Awad Kazem, President of the Statistics and Geospatial Information Authority in Iraq; Dr. Khalifa Al-Barwani, Chief Executive Officer at National Centre for Statistics and Information in Oman; Ms. Zehra Zümrüt SELÇUK, Director General of SESRIC; Mr. Rafeal Diaz, Senior Statistician at ILO; and Dr. Ziad Abdullah, Director General of the Arab Institute for Training and Statistical Research.

During the meetings, Dr. Fahad Aldossari emphasized GASTAT's commitment to strengthening its international and regional partnerships to develop methodologies, enhance the efficiency of statistical systems, expand the scope of open data, and keep pace with global technological advancements in the field of statistics and analysis.

The Saudi Statistics Forum is a significant national platform for activating statistical cooperation, promoting capacity building, and transferring knowledge. It was held with the participation of prominent statistical leaders, decision-makers, and local and international experts, and was attended by over 300 participants from various entities related to statistical work.
 

المنتدى السعودي للإحصاء يختتم أعماله بثلاث جلساتٍ حوارية

28-04-2025

اختتم المنتدى السعودي للإحصاء أعماله في يومه الأخير بثلاث جلسات حوارية تناولت عددًا من الموضوعات والمحاور الرئيسة في القطاع الإحصائي، بمشاركة عدد من ممثلي المنظمات الدولية والخبراء المحليين والدوليين وصناع القرار.
وشهدت أعمال اليوم الثاني والأخير جلسة حوارية  بعنوان: (الابتكار والتطوير في الأساليب الإحصائية) تحدث المشاركون فيها حول دور التقنيات المبتكرة في تغيير وتحديث طريقة إنتاج البيانات وجمعها وتحليلها عبر مختلف المجالات وتوظيف تقنيات الاستشعار عن بعد والصور من الأقمار الصناعية في الإحصاءات الجغرافية والزراعية واستخدام الأساليب الإحصائية لتحليل الاتجاهات والتوقعات المستقبلية إضافة إلى رفع الوعي بأتمتة العمليات الإحصائية ودور الابتكار الإحصائي في رفع مستوى الثقة في الإحصاءات الرسمية.
فيما خصصت الجلسة الحوارية الرابعة لموضوع: "دور القطاع الخاص في دعم وإنتاج البيانات الإحصائية " والتي تناقش فيها عدد من المختصين في القطاع الإحصائي  حول دور القطاع الخاص في دعم وإنتاج البيانات الإحصائية والتكامل بين المؤسسات الإحصائية ومستخدمي البيانات، إضافة إلى أهمية مساهمة مكونات القطاع الخاص من الشركات والمؤسسات الخاصة في توفير البيانات وإنتاج الإحصاءات ذات العلاقة بالقطاع الخاص أو النطاق التنموي الوطني بشكل عام، والتحديات التي تواجهه في إنتاج البيانات وتوفيرها بجودة عالية، وأهمية البيانات الضخمة وابتكارات التحليل الإحصائي في تحسين جودة التقديرات والمؤشرات الاقتصادية وفرص تعزيز الشراكة بين القطاعين العام والخاص لتطوير مصادر بيانات دقيقة تدعم القرارات الاقتصادية والتنموية. 
واستعرضت الجلسة الأخيرة “أهمية التكامل بين المؤسسات الإحصائية ومستخدمي البيانات" وناقشت سبل تعزيز العلاقة بين المكاتب الإحصائية والمستفيدين، وذلك من خلال تسهيل الوصول إلى بيانات ومؤشرات المنتجات الإحصائية وتقديمها بأشكال متعددة وخدمات متنوعة، والتأكيد على العمل المستمر لتطوير مستوى العلاقة والتواصل من خلال توفير منصات قادرة على تقديم البيانات بطريقة آمنة، وبصيغ رقمية متنوعة مدعومة بالرسوم البيانية والجداول والتصاميم التوضيحية وفق أفضل الممارسات والمعايير والتقنيات المحلية والعالمية. 

GASTAT signs four agreements on last day of Saudi Statistics Forum

28-04-2025

GASTAT signed four agreements on the concluding day of the Saudi Statistics Forum. The event was held under the patronage of His Excellency the Minister of Economy and Planning, Chairman of GASTAT’s Board of Directors. It brought together several ministers, heads and representatives of international organizations and statistical offices, local and international experts and decision-makers in the statistical sector.

The cooperation agreements were signed with the Riyadh Chamber, Jeddah University, the Social Development Bank, and ROSHN Group. The agreements aim to strengthen collaboration, enhance coordination, and integrate efforts across the parties' areas of expertise. They also establish an institutional framework for joint activities and tasks, while supporting the development of institutional capacities in areas of mutual interest.

The areas of cooperation focused on several strategic tracks, most notably the exchange of technical support and expertise according to each party’s specialization, strengthening partnerships in the development of statistical products and indicators, improving the quality of statistical data, and promoting statistical awareness across various sectors.

GASTAT's president, Dr. Fahad Aldossari, emphasized that strengthening cooperation with government and private sectors is a key pillar in achieving national and sustainable development goals. He emphasized that the exchange of statistical data and expertise contributes to enhancing institutional performance efficiency, meeting the needs of various stakeholders, and anticipating future trends for the development of statistical products and services, thereby strengthening the national economy and raising public awareness that supports comprehensive development.

It is worth noting that GASTAT is the only official statistical reference for statistical data and information in Saudi Arabia. It plays a key role in collecting, analyzing, and studying statistical data and information to support decision-makers and policy-makers.

 

Two panel discussions open the first day of the Saudi Statistics Forum

27-04-2025

On its first day, the Saudi Statistics Forum — held under the patronage of His Excellency the Minister of Economy and Planning and Chairman of the Board of Directors of the General Authority for Statistics — witnessed the attendance of a number of Their Highnesses and Excellencies, ministers, heads and representatives of international organizations and statistical offices, local and international experts, and decision-makers in the statistical sector, along with more than 300 individuals interested in statistical work.

The first panel discussion at the forum, titled “The Role of Statistics in Policy Development and Decision-making,” featured the participation of His Excellency the Minister of Industry and Mineral Resources, Mr. Bandar bin Ibrahim AlKhorayef, and His Excellency the President of the General Authority for Statistics, Dr. Fahad bin Abdullah Al-Dossari.

The session discussed the impact of collaboration and integration between national statistical offices and governmental and private entities in decision-making and enhancing developmental outcomes. It also addressed the importance of statistical indicators in measuring the success of policies and aligning them with national targets, in addition to highlighting the critical role of statistical data as a fundamental pillar in shaping public policies, making decisions, and setting national priorities.

The second panel discussion was dedicated to the topic of "International Statistical Methodologies and Practices". It featured the participation of the President of the General Authority for Statistics, along with several heads of statistical offices, representatives of international organizations, and several local and international experts. The participants discussed the importance of globally recognized statistical standards and classifications, the unification of methodologies to ensure comparability between countries, and the role of modern technologies in advancing statistical methodologies. They also addressed the challenges facing statistical practices and emphasized the importance of ensuring reliability and transparency in official statistics.

It is worth noting that the Saudi Statistics Forum will continue its specialized sessions focusing on the statistical sector, covering a range of topics such as innovation and development in statistical methods, the role of the private sector in supporting and producing statistical data, and the integration between statistical institutions and data users. These efforts are part of the forum’s broader goal to develop a comprehensive national statistical system that supports decision-making and contributes to achieving sustainable development goals.
